Y'2 Leather
Y'2 Leather produces leather jackets the way they used to be – raw, honest, uncompromising. Founded in 1998 by Takao Yanamoto, who already had four decades of experience in leather processing. The workshop in Osaka has since been the center of a craft that follows its own path unfailingly.
Y'2 Leather works closely with small Japanese tanneries to develop exclusive leathers – such as indigo-dyed or horse leather tanned with fermented kakishibu fruit juice. Completely without pigments, so that the natural structure is preserved and a patina develops over time, which is otherwise impossible.
